3-(Pyridin-3-yl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-5-amine

Description:
3-(Pyridin-3-yl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-5-amine, with the CAS number 35607-27-3, is a chemical compound characterized by its triazole ring structure, which is a five-membered heterocyclic compound containing three nitrogen atoms. This substance features a pyridine moiety, contributing to its aromatic properties and potential biological activity. The presence of the amino group at the 5-position of the triazole ring enhances its reactivity and solubility in polar solvents. This compound is of interest in medicinal chemistry due to its potential applications in pharmaceuticals, particularly as an antifungal or antimicrobial agent. Its structural characteristics may allow for interactions with biological targets, making it a candidate for further research in drug development. Additionally, the compound's stability and reactivity can be influenced by the electronic effects of the pyridine ring and the triazole nitrogen atoms, which may affect its behavior in various chemical environments. Overall, 3-(Pyridin-3-yl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-5-amine represents a versatile scaffold for further exploration in chemical and biological research.
Formula:C7H7N5
InChI:InChI=1S/C7H7N5/c8-7-10-6(11-12-7)5-2-1-3-9-4-5/h1-4H,(H3,8,10,11,12)
InChI key:InChIKey=USTVEFNDQUIZNC-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:NC=1NC(=NN1)C=2C=CC=NC2
Synonyms:
  • 1H-1,2,4-Triazol-3-amine, 5-(3-pyridinyl)-
  • 1H-1,2,4-Triazol-5-amine, 3-(3-pyridinyl)-
  • 3-(3-Pyridinyl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-5-amine
  • 3-(3-Pyridyl)-5-amino-1,2,4-triazole
  • 3-(Pyridin-3-yl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-5-amine
  • 3-Amino-5-(3-pyridyl)-1,2,4-triazole
  • 5-(pyridin-3-yl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-3-amine
  • Pyridine, 3-(5-amino-s-triazol-3-yl)-
